Eastern Market Brewing Co. Announces Expansion and Statewide Distribution

Elephant Juice is going statewide: Eastern Market Brewing Co. announces a contract brewing search and a statewide distribution push that could make it one of Michigan's largest breweries.

Detroit, MI — April 23, 2026 — Eastern Market Brewing Co., one of Detroit's most celebrated craft breweries, today announced a landmark growth strategy that will significantly expand its production capacity and bring its flagship beers to consumers across Michigan for the first time.

The brewery has launched a formal search process with several of Michigan's largest brewing facilities to identify a contract brewing partner for its core Eastern Market Brewing Co. brands, led by Elephant Juice, the brewery's best-selling and fastest-growing beer. A partner is expected to be selected in May, with production beginning in June and statewide distribution launching this summer.

The production expansion is paired with a statewide Michigan distribution strategy that builds on what the brewery has already accomplished through self-distribution. Eastern Market Brewing Co. is the only self-distributing craft brewery with placement in Michigan's major retail chains, but geographic constraints have limited that reach to the metro Detroit market. Statewide distribution removes that ceiling entirely.

“For years, our self-distribution business has been our most important competitive advantage,” said Dayne Bartscht, Founder. “We built something nobody else in Michigan has done at our scale, and we did it intentionally. This is the moment that investment pays off. The rights to our brands statewide have significant value, and we structured this expansion accordingly.”

A Detroit brand going statewide.

Eastern Market Brewing Co. was founded in Detroit and has grown into one of the city's most recognized craft beer brands, with a taproom in Eastern Market and an experimental brewing arm, Ferndale Project, in Ferndale. The breweries collectively rank among the top 10 largest in Michigan and continue to grow at a moment when most in the industry are standing still.

The move to contract brewing and statewide distribution is expected to increase Elephant Juice IPA production alone by seven times its current volume, a jump that could put Eastern Market Brewing Co. in the top five largest breweries in Michigan overnight.

“We started Eastern Market Brewing Co. in 2017 because we looked at the Michigan craft beer landscape and realized that Detroit didn't have a brewery competing at the highest level. The west side of the state had all the players,” said Dayne Bartscht. “Everything we've built since has been pointed at closing that gap. Going statewide isn't new. It was always the destination.”

The strategic logic.

The craft beer market is contracting nationally, with major retail chains reducing shelf space for underperforming craft brands. For Eastern Market Brewing Co., that contraction creates opportunity on two fronts. As struggling brands lose placements, shelf space is opening up for breweries with the velocity data to back them up. And as Michigan's largest breweries face declining volumes, they have excess capacity and every reason to partner with a brand that can fill it. Eastern Market Brewing Co. offers exactly that, gaining access to scale it cannot replicate on its own at a significantly lower cost per barrel than brewing independently.

The brewery is in the midst of a competitive search process with several of Michigan's largest brewing facilities, inviting them to submit proposals to produce Eastern Market Brewing Co.'s flagship brands. The process is designed to identify the partner best positioned to meet the brewery's standards for quality, freshness, and scale while bringing down production costs.

“Elephant Juice has always been defined by its freshness. Our self-distribution model has allowed it to hit shelves sometimes the same day it's packaged, and that obsession with freshness doesn't change as we grow. What changes is how many people get to experience it,” said Bartscht. “We are being deliberate about who we partner with because the beer has to be exactly what our customers expect—just available to a whole lot more people.”

What's next for the Eastern Market Brewing Co. portfolio.

Elephant Juice leads the statewide expansion, followed by Wunderboi, the brewery's easy-drinking light beer and top taproom seller, and Detroit-Style, its fastest-growing brand. Pineapple Market Day IPA, which briefly surpasses Elephant Juice as the brewery's highest-volume beer during its annual release, is planned for statewide distribution next spring.

As flagship beers move to a contract brewer, all remaining brand production returns to Ferndale Project, which continues to serve as the innovation hub for developing and testing the next generation of Eastern Market Brewing Co. brands. At the same time, brewing activity increases at the Eastern Market taproom and Elephant & Co. Detroit, where small-batch releases and rotating taps will give guests more variety and fresher beer than ever before.

What started as a community brewery in the heart of Detroit is becoming something bigger. Eastern Market Brewing Co. is not just growing. It is positioning itself as the defining craft brewery of eastern Michigan, with the brands, infrastructure, and strategy to match.

About Eastern Market Brewing Co.

Eastern Market Brewing Co. is a community-driven brewery in the heart of Detroit, known for innovation. Founded in 2017, the brewery has grown into one of Michigan's most recognized independent craft beer brands, with a taproom in Eastern Market, an experimental brewing arm at Ferndale Project, and Elephant & Co., a Detroit-style pizza and sports destination.
